中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

codeblocks在c++網絡編程中的支持情況如何

c++
小樊
87
2024-09-24 22:11:03
欄目: 編程語言

Code::Blocks是一個流行的C++集成開發環境(IDE),它通常支持多種編程語言,包括C++。對于C++網絡編程,Code::Blocks提供了基本的庫和框架支持,使得開發者可以編寫網絡應用程序。

在Code::Blocks中,你可以使用多種方法來實現C++網絡編程。以下是一些常用的方法:

  1. 使用原生的套接字API:Code::Blocks支持C++的原生套接字編程API,如socketbindlistenacceptconnectsendrecv等。這些API提供了較低層次的網絡編程接口,適用于需要更精細控制網絡通信的場景。
  2. 使用Boost.Asio庫:Boost.Asio是一個廣泛使用的C++網絡編程庫,它提供了異步、事件驅動的網絡編程接口。Code::Blocks支持Boost.Asio庫,你可以使用它來編寫高性能、可擴展的網絡應用程序。
  3. 使用Poco庫:Poco是一個流行的C++網絡編程庫,它提供了豐富的網絡編程功能,包括TCP/UDP服務、線程池、定時器等。Code::Blocks也支持Poco庫,你可以使用它來簡化網絡編程任務。

需要注意的是,雖然Code::Blocks支持這些網絡編程庫和框架,但你可能需要自行配置和鏈接相應的庫文件。此外,對于某些高級的網絡編程功能,你可能還需要深入了解底層的網絡協議和機制。

總的來說,Code::Blocks在C++網絡編程方面提供了基本的庫和框架支持,但你可能需要具備一定的C++網絡編程知識和經驗才能充分利用這些功能。

0
斗六市| 工布江达县| 清水河县| 武邑县| 十堰市| 洛阳市| 杨浦区| 南投县| 淮滨县| 阿拉善左旗| 房山区| 高安市| 龙州县| 乳源| 乐平市| 专栏| 西乡县| 乐昌市| 于田县| 沾化县| 六盘水市| 托克逊县| 鄂托克前旗| 宝鸡市| 兴仁县| 岳阳市| 宣城市| 黄大仙区| 保亭| 钟祥市| 彰武县| 玉屏| 尉氏县| 普陀区| 石柱| 永丰县| 东丽区| 华容县| 岚皋县| 将乐县| 乐业县|